Because you can’t let Johnny Depp and the Pirates of the Caribbean have all the fun, Dwayne Johnson and Disney are moving forward with the long-delayed Jungle Cruise movie.  

The movie, which will shoot next year, has capsized a number of times. This take on a Jungle Cruise film was re-envisioned in 2011 as a live-action reunion for Toy Story's Tom Hanks and Tim Allen.  

Then in August 2015, Johnson came aboard with the Focus team of John Requa and Glenn Ficarra, who would re-write the script for more of a period setting than the original modern-day plan.

Since then, there have been numerous redrafts with J.D. Payne and Patrick McKay working on the most recent draft and no idea of what the movie might hold in store beyond the obvious concept of a cruise going badly for our hero. 

Then there’s the small matter of Johnson's packed schedule which as well as this year’s Baywatch includes Jumanji 2, Rampage and then segues to Skyscraper later in the year.A spring 2018 shooting date should give Johnson and his regular producing partner Dany Garcia enough time to find a suitable director.
